Israeli citizen living abroad is planning to use his funds to buy an apartment

Q: Hi, my father, an Israeli citizen living abroad is planning to use his funds to buy an apartment for myself and my sisters in or around Tel Aviv. My status in Israel is ezrach oleh as I made aliyah in January 08. Would purchasing an apartment under his name, or mine name have any difference as to what discounts the government give. Also, can you suggest any suitable affordable neighborhood in/around Tel Aviv for young 21-24 working people.

A: If your dad has NEVER owned any home in Israel, he might have some small rights as a first time buyer. You on the other hand, have MORE rights as an olah chadasha. You are entitled to a small subsidized olah mortgage, plus a significant discount on the one-time purchase tax called mas Rechisha. It sounds to me like it would be best to be under yourname. Probably, the ownership should be in one of your names, not in multiple names,,,
